About “Murder on Safari”
The book centers on the disappearance of valuable jewelry during a safari in Chania, where Lady Baradale, a wealthy and controversial woman, is accompanied by her chauffeur and a guide named Billy de Mare. Superintendent Vachell, sent to investigate the theft, becomes entangled in a murder case after a killer strikes, shifting the focus from the robbery to a more urgent threat to life.
